  1. Mentors for military podcast

 

   If you want to find out more about real service life from different angles, then you'll like this series of podcasts. "Mentors for Military Podcast" is a show held by 18 veterans. They invite guests to have a good talk every week. During these sessions, they discuss inspiring stories.

   The particularity of this show is its atmosphere: veterans and their guests talk about everything that stays behind military life. Army Rangers, service relations, real-life experience, special forces – you'll hear plenty of exciting topics.

 

   2. Team never quit podcasts

 

   There are many never-ending stories in the military. Marcus Luttrell, who is Lone Survivor, knows a lot about it. That's why he invites guests to his show to talk about people, events, and things that could never be forgotten.

   It's important to know that his guests are very interesting people. You can find a podcast with Mike Pence (Vice President), Will Chesney (who participated in taking down Bin Laden), Lanny and Tracy Barnes (famous twins, Olympic biathletes), Matt Long (9/11 Survivor), and many other people with inspiring experiences and stories.    3. Veterans chronicles

 

   It is said that nobody has a future without knowing the past, and we agree with this statement. That's why we want to know more about our heroes, their acts of bravery, and further living. And this hour-long program "Veterans chronics" exactly describes these topics.

   This show is based on happy, tragic, small, huge, and other important events in our history. It refers to the perspective of people who participated in different historical situations. So listening to the show with real guests' interviews and archival recordings will create a full image of the past in your head.

   4. For the sake of the child

 

   Military serving isn't only about soldiers and their spouses. All events influence their kids, relatives, and friends too. For this reason, it's highly important to support military-connected people nowadays.

   The podcast "For the sake of the child" is exactly about this underrated problem. It aims not only to reveal the consequences of military kids but also to share experiences, life scenarios, and solutions for the future.

 

   5. Home bound veteran

 

   Yesterday you were a soldier, and today you are just a human – this is a challenge for everybody. It doesn't seem hard at the first sight to follow a transition from the past to a new life but it does. Veterans experience numerous issues during this period so it's important for them to know they're not alone.

   "Home bound veteran" – is a podcast about this transition period. It reveals several real stories of veterans describing how they start living a civilian life.

 

   6. Mind of the warrior

 

   No human can develop oneself without regular activities. You can be a tutor in college, online transcriber, fitness coach, surgeon, or anyone else – and you still require motivation for living. If you are focused on self-improvement and want to scale your personal achievements then you need this podcast.

   "Mind of the warrior" is a very strong and inspiring podcast. It is made by Mike Simpson, an MMA fight doctor and former operator of the Special Forces. He will help you focus on your mindset of a warrior to make a victory real no matter the type of your battle (on the battlefield elsewhere or personal life).

   7. SOFREP Radio

 

   If you prefer the combination of different topics with the military approach you'll truly enjoy the SOFREP Radio. This is a show made by Jack Murphy (a member of Green Beret) and Brandon Webb (a former sniper in Navy SEAL). These guys would be glad to discuss any topics with you and always welcome cool guests from the military community.

   The show isn't dedicated to military topics only. You can listen to discussions about modern terrorism, national and foreign policy, warfare, and so on.

 

   8. Women of the military podcast

 

   We used to know that military life means courage, bravery, and heroism. Mostly these descriptions are used for men. But a woman in the army isn't an exception nowadays.

   The podcast "Women of the military" is made by Amanda Huffman, a veteran of the Air Force. Thanks to her podcasts, you can reveal a unique female experience as a military officer and spouse. She also invites guests to scale discussions on numerous topics.

 

   9. Military wives unfiltered podcast

 

   It's fair to say that nowadays we feel a lack of honesty and truth. That's why if we see hashtags like #nofilter or #unfiltered we are positively surprised and can't wait to reveal the real-life stories. This is the main reason for the "Military wives unfiltered podcast" to become so popular.

   It is run by 2 military wives. If you are new to military life or haven't someone who understands you then this is it! Girls discuss everything starting from self-identification to military humor. Remember there is no filter so the truth is guaranteed.
